Oak Island, NC Rental Market Trends
Last updated: October 20, 2025 | Source: RentCafe Market Analysis, Yardi Matrix, U.S. Census Bureau
Highlights
The average rent for an apartment in Oak Island is $1,721, a 1.02% decrease compared to the previous year, when the average rent was $1,738.
One-bedroom apartments provide 793 square feet for $1,488, balancing privacy and affordability.
Two-beedroom units at $1,812 offer 1,166 square feet, perfect for roommates or small families.
Three-bedroom apartments deliver maximum space (1,296 sq ft) for $2,012, suitable for larger households.

Oak Island, NC rent trends
Rental prices in Oak Island, NC have decreased by 1.02% over the past year. The average rent moved from $1,738 to $1,721.
What's the typical rent budget in Oak Island, NC?
The largest share of rentals in Oak Island, NC (73%) fall between $1,501-$2,000 per month. This suggests that most people succesfully find suitable apartments within this price.
Do most people rent or own in Oak Island, NC?
525 or 12% of the households in Oak Island, NC are renter-occupied while 3,779 or 88% are owner-occupied.

Where this data comes from
The rental statistics on this page were compiled by RentCafe.com, a nationwide apartment search website trusted by millions of renters to find apartments and houses for rent throughout the U.S.
Rent prices, trends, and apartment sizes were calculated based on data from our sister company, Yardi Matrix, an apartment market intelligence solution that covers approximately 90% of the U.S. metro area population. The data includes comprehensive information on all Oak Island apartment buildings with 50 or more units, totaling 23.5 million apartments across 181 U.S. markets.
Housing composition data was s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au, using the most recently available information by tenure.
